Robert E. Norton is a scholar working on Demography, Sociology and Political Science and Political Science and International Rel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ert E. Norton has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 261 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Demography, 10 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 5 papers in Political Science and International Relations. Recurrent topics in Robert E. Norton’s work include Island Studies and Pacific Affairs (23 papers), Pacific and Southeast Asian Studies (5 papers) and Australian History and Society (5 papers). Robert E. Norton is often cited by papers focused on Island Studies and Pacific Affairs (23 papers), Pacific and Southeast Asian Studies (5 papers) and Australian History and Society (5 papers). Robert E. Norton collaborates with scholars based in Australia and United States. Robert E. Norton's co-authors include H. B. Nisbet, Catherine Lord, Ron Crocombe, Ulrich Gaier, Paul Bishop and Raymond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Ethnic and Racial Studies, Pacific Affairs and Journal of Aesthetics and Art Criticism.
